phpwamp单身狗模式的详解与分析,单身狗模式/即霸体模式的作用讲解。-阿里云开发者社区

开发者社区> 技术小甜> 正文

phpwamp单身狗模式的详解与分析,单身狗模式/即霸体模式的作用讲解。

简介:
+关注继续查看

最近有学生在使用PHPWAMP的时候,问我霸体模式的作用。


1
2
3
4
5
学生问:老师,PHPWAMP里面的霸体模式是什么意思,有什么用?
 
回答:额、、、就是以前我发布测试版的时候,模式切换里面的单身狗模式。
 
学生:单身狗?我表示测试版我没有用过啊、、、、



早在PHPWAMP8.1.8.8正式版发布之前,我曾经对部分用户发布了8.1.8.8的测试版,测试版里新增了“共生模式”与“单身狗模式”,发布没多久网友就纷纷向我吐槽、、、、


1
2
3
4
5
6
7
8
9
10
11
网友A:单身狗模式是什么鬼,名字能不能取的好听点
 
网友B:我了个乖乖,单身狗模式,是在嘲笑我们程序员都是单身狗么。
 
网友C:看到这名字,我无力吐槽。
 
网友D: 原本高端大气上档次,现在低端粗俗无节操。
 
网友E:本来软件看着挺不错的,功能等各方面看着挺专业的,看到单身狗模式,瞬间变逗逼了
 
网友F:对啊,赞同楼上,看到单身狗模式,瞬间就不想用了,我还是继续用旧版本phpwamp8.1.6.8好了


为了不被吐槽,发布正式版的时候我把单身狗模式改成了霸体模式




先来介绍如何切换到霸体模式,然后再来介绍霸体模式的作用与推出原因

打开软件后,点击菜单上面的相关设置,找到“集成环境模式切换”下的“霸体模式”。wKioL1h26I-j2224AAEBO--FHH0147.png


切换模式就是这么简单,下面开始说明霸体模式的作用和推出霸体模式的原因。




霸体模式的作用

霸体模式其实就是启动环境的时候,瞬间轰掉Kangle、Apache、Tomcat、Nginx等WEB服务器以及其他关联程序。目的是为了避免其他运行环境的相关残留影响了环境本身的运行。(与之相对的共生模式,可与其他任意环境共存)

共生模式与多开档位的详解:http://lccee.blog.51cto.com/10514884/1890945



  • 霸体模式下,只能运行自身,所以测试版的时候,我才取名为“单身狗模式”


  • 霸体模式下,PHPWAMP启动速度快了很多。

    原因分析:启动的时候不需要纠错,不走常规路线,不需要对服务进行卸载等操作,而是瞬间干掉,省略了一些步骤。


  • 霸体模式下,面对一些集成环境的自行启动造成的影响也能免除。

    原因分析:有些集成环境的残留程序会自动判断目前程序是否启动,如果不存在则会自动运行,该残留程序启动时会处在占用状态,有些集成环境的制作者在做卸载程序的时候,忘记解除此模块的占用造成的,该残留模块会影响电脑重装其他运行环境。


友情提示:该模式完全不会影响系统其他非同类软件,如果想用回其他同类环境,重新安装即可,使用PHPWAMP的时候还想使用其他环境互不影响的话,切换到共生模式即可,有如上需求的才使用霸体模式。



推出霸体模式的原因

其它用户安装的PHP环境,无论是自主安装的,还是使用的集成环境,有时候卸载不完全造成新的环境搭建异常,卸载不完全的原因无非就是卸载过程中,系统出现异常,其次就是某些集成环境的自身卸载程序卸载的不干净或者是绿化的不到位造成的卸载不完全,卸载后还是会影响电脑安装新的环境,因此我推出了霸体模式。




欢迎光临Lccee博客,查看更多博文:http://lccee.blog.51cto.com/


51CTO相关文章推荐:

自定义设置任意PHP版本教程:http://lccee.blog.51cto.com/10514884/1886154

PHP连接MSSQL数据库案例:http://lccee.blog.51cto.com/10514884/1889722

PHPWAMP在云服务器上的应用:http://lccee.blog.51cto.com/10514884/1887604

网页加密与网页乱码最详细的分析:http://lccee.blog.51cto.com/10514884/1886461

虚拟主机搭建网站的全程视频案例http://lccee.blog.51cto.com/10514884/1886460

强制修改所有mysql数据库密码:http://lccee.blog.51cto.com/10514884/1886402

强制去除域名端口号(独家功能):http://lccee.blog.51cto.com/10514884/1886424

700个PHP版本随时切换,共生模式与多开档位:http://lccee.blog.51cto.com/10514884/1890945













本文转自Lccee老师里冲51CTO博客,原文链接: http://blog.51cto.com/lccee/1891271,如需转载请自行联系原作者



版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。

相关文章
MaxCompute Studio使用心得系列3——可视化分析作业运行
我们很熟悉的是通过Logview 去分析作业的执行情况,logview上有很详细的执行日志,而Studio不仅仅提供可视化的信息,还会明确给出一些分析结论如job是有否长尾或数据倾斜情况。
3356 0
一致性哈希算法的php实现与分析-算法
<?php/** 一致性哈希算法* 过程:* 1,抽象一个圆,然后把服务器节点按一定算法得到整数有序顺时针放到圆上,圆环用2^32 个点来进行均匀切割。* hash函数的结果应该均匀分布在[0,2^32-1]区间* 2,由于服务器少,在圆上分布不均匀会造成数据倾斜,所以我们使用虚拟节点代替服务器的节点,一个服务器生成32个虚拟节点,或者更多。
1359 0
安装php 找不到lib.so包原因分析
<p class="p15" style="margin-top:0pt; margin-bottom:0pt; padding-top:0px; padding-bottom:0px; font-family:Arial; font-size:14px; line-height:26px"> 一般我们在Linux下执行某些外部程序的时候可能会提示找不到共享库的错误, 比如:</p>
2094 0
php爬虫:知乎用户数据爬取和分析
php爬虫爬取知乎用户数据分析
2530 0
+关注
6323
文章
0
问答
文章排行榜
最热
最新
相关电子书
更多
文娱运维技术
立即下载
《SaaS模式云原生数据仓库应用场景实践》
立即下载
《看见新力量:二》电子书
立即下载